This dataset contains input and sample output data from WRF-VPRM (Weather Research and Forecasting model coupled with the Vegetation Photosynthesis and Respiration Model) simulations conducted over complex alpine topography. It accompanies the manuscript "Sensitivity of CO2 exchange in WRF-VPRM to model resolution and parameter settings over Alpine topography" (Geoscientific Model Development, in review). Contents Input data: - CAMS subset — CO2 initial and boundary conditions from the Copernicus Atmosphere Monitoring Service- VPRM input — CORINE land cover, MODIS-derived vegetation indices (EVI, LSWI), and pre-processed VPRM parameter fields (generated via pyVPRM and vprm_shapeshifter)- FLUXNET2015 — reference site data used for VPRM parameter optimisation and model validation Sample model output: - One day (2012-07-27) of WRF-VPRM hourly output across the nested domains (54 km, 27 km, 9 km, 3 km, 1 km). The full multi-month simulation output is ~5 TB and is not redistributed. Not included here (archived in the companion records): - Modified WRF source code → DOI 10.5281/zenodo.20395505 (https://doi.org/10.5281/zenodo.20395505)- Modified WPS source code → DOI 10.5281/zenodo.20395507 (https://doi.org/10.5281/zenodo.20395507)- Workflow, namelists, post-processing scripts, and extracted site-level / domain-averaged time series CSVs used to generate the paper figures → DOI 10.5281/zenodo.20395509 (https://doi.org/10.5281/zenodo.20395509) Model setup The simulations use a coupled WRF-VPRM framework to simulate CO2 fluxes over the Alps. Key components: - Meteorological boundary conditions from ERA5 reanalysis- CO2 initial and boundary conditions from CAMS (Copernicus Atmosphere Monitoring Service)- VPRM parameters optimised using differential evolution against FLUXNET2015 site observations- MODIS satellite data for vegetation indices (EVI, LSWI)- CORINE Land Cover 2018 for land-surface classification Note on prior versions Versions v0.1 and v2 of this record bundled WRF and WPS source code, but those bundles contained upstream code rather than the modified WRF-P and WRF-VPRM-CLC branches actually used in the paper. The modified source is now archived in the three separate records linked above. This v0.2 release retains only the data files.
